A Diamond Doser water-driven proportioner is a mechanical chemical injection system enabling automated metering of foam concentrate into water streams without requiring electric power enabling deployment across remote locations and mobile firefighting operations. The water-driven mechanism provides reliable operation across decades without maintenance dependency on external electrical infrastructure.

The proportioner architecture employs water pressure differential across an internal restriction creating suction drawing foam concentrate from storage reservoir into the water stream at proportional rates. Venturi effect creates low-pressure zone drawing concentrate into flowing water achieving thorough mixing. Adjustment mechanisms enable selection of concentration ratios (typically 0.5–3% concentrate) matching specific foam formulation requirements and fuel type.

Operational integration into fire apparatus water delivery systems occurs at discharge manifold enabling proportional foam application at monitor nozzles or deck guns. Simple installation eliminates complex hydraulic or electrical modifications required for power-driven proportioners. Mechanical simplicity ensures continued operation despite sand, salt, or debris contamination potentially disabling electronic systems.

Flow rate capacity typically spans 100–500 GPM (gallons per minute) enabling deployment across portable hand-line systems through large fixed installations. Durability across decades of operation enables amortisation across extended service life reducing cost per application.

Limitations include lack of precise concentration control compared to electronically-modulated proportioners and inability to remotely adjust proportions during operation requiring manual adjustment at installation.
